This 1978 Chevrolet Corvette Indy 500 Pace Car Limited Edition Coupe is an incredibly well-preserved, ultra-low-mileage time capsule showing just 12,079 original miles from new. As documented by its original factory window sticker and original dealer purchase order, this car was assembled at the St. Louis, Missouri plant and delivered new to Lockwood Chevrolet Inc. in Herscher, Illinois. Purchased on May 20, 1978, by its original owner, Duane Phillips of Kankakee, Illinois, this Corvette represents a rare opportunity to acquire a highly original, beautifully documented piece of automotive history. We are proud to note that we have the original factory window sticker and the original dealer invoice from when the car was brand new.

Important Mechanical Condition Note: Blown Original Engine
This Corvette was meticulously maintained throughout its life and was an excellent driver prior to its recent mechanical failure. The vehicle is now being sold with its original, numbers-matching motor explicitly in non-running, blown condition. Despite receiving regular care and recent service work, the oil pump unfortunately failed while driving on the highway in 2025. By the time the owner noticed the sudden drop in oil pressure, the internal damage had already been done.

Upon inspection, we located a hole in the oil pan, which is directly indicative of a broken connecting rod or a broken crankshaft. We have drained a good portion of the oil out of the engine, but we have not touched, disassembled, or altered the motor beyond this visual inspection. We do not see any signs of external damage to the engine block itself; however, we cannot confirm its internal status. We are hopeful that the engine block remains salvageable for a proper rebuild to preserve the car's numbers-matching lineage. Because the car is currently non-running, we cannot test any of the auxiliary mechanical or vacuum features, such as the air conditioning system, transmission engagement, or power functions.

Body, Paint & Exterior Presentation
Cosmetically, this Pace Car is a stunning, largely untouched survivor. The exterior appears to completely retain its original factory paint and special edition decals, which present in excellent condition. The fiberglass body lines are perfectly straight, and there are very few minor blemishes to be found anywhere on the exterior. The tires are in good shape with plenty of tread. The glass roof panels are nice, and the factory aluminum wheels present beautifully. We also have the original factory T-Top storage pouches preserved in the back.

Interior Condition
The original Silver and Smoke leather interior is in absolutely fantastic shape, easily supporting the car's low 12,079-mile odometer reading. The bucket seats are nearly perfect with excellent bolster structure and minimal wear. The dash, door panels, console, and instrumentation all show beautifully. The original factory floor mats are still present as well. The cabin is entirely smoke-free with no signs of past smoking or unwanted interior odors.
